Adding better GPS to plane

Featured Replies

Im thinking about getting the Reality XP's GNS 430 or 530 GPS and putting it into some of my Carenado planes. Specifically the Archer II. Ive never edited a panel before. Is it hard to do? Does it just add it as a pop-up panel or does it show up in the VC as well? Are there any tutorials around for doing this?Thanks for any advice.Rob

No it's not really hard to do. Make sure the panel does not have 3D knobs. I can't remember if the Archer does or not. I have the GNS430W in my Seneca and Arrow. The edits were fairly straightforward. All you do is find a good spot for it and copy and past the new gauge name where the old one once was.For instance, you'll want to find the Vcockpit section and here's two lines from my Arrow edit//gauge14=FsGpsCarenado2!gps_500, 274, 3 ,155,130gauge14=rxpGNS!GNS430, 274, 60 ,150,70gauge 14 the original is replaced by RXP's unit, and in this case I edited the size and shape of the gauge to fit the panel (four numbers)Here's a quick n dirty pic of the Seneca... its an older pic, because I deleted the default gps completely nowgns439PA34.jpg
